53 * The !gapspci_config_access case really shouldn't happen, ever, unless
54 * someone implicitly messes around with the last devfn value.. otherwise we
55 * only support a single device anyways, and if we didn't have a BBA, we
56 * wouldn't make it terribly far through the PCI setup anyways.
58 * Also, we could very easily support both Type 0 and Type 1 configurations
59 * here, but since it doesn't seem that there is any such implementation in
60 * existence, we don't bother.
62 * I suppose if someone actually gets around to ripping the chip out of
63 * the BBA and hanging some more devices off of it, then this might be
64 * something to take into consideration. However, due to the cost of the BBA,
65 * and the general lack of activity by DC hardware hackers, this doesn't seem
66 * likely to happen anytime soon.
